Great American Brass Band Festival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 149,186 | 155,444 | −6,258 | 1.3 | 16% |
| 2012 | 166,035 | 149,127 | 16,908 | 2.7 | 11% |
| 2013 | 156,645 | 158,848 | −2,203 | 2.4 | 19% |
| 2014 | 170,985 | 178,092 | −7,107 | 1.6 | 20% |
| 2015 | 175,595 | 175,631 | −36 | 1.6 | 24% |
| 2016 | 209,220 | 205,456 | 3,764 | 1.6 | 24% |
| 2017 | 221,962 | 205,489 | 16,473 | 2.6 | 27% |
| 2018 | 170,375 | 187,101 | −16,726 | 1.8 | 23% |
| 2019 | 130,807 | 170,023 | −39,216 | -0.8 | 23% |
| 2020 | 86,181 | 57,190 | 28,991 | 3.7 | 56% |
| 2021 | 116,187 | 86,284 | 29,903 | 6.6 | 32% |
| 2022 | 169,899 | 158,859 | 11,040 | 4.4 | 21% |
| 2023 | 228,997 | 216,307 | 12,690 | 3.9 | 17% |
| 2024 | 187,428 | 226,278 | −38,850 | 1.7 | 23% |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ization spent $38,850 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 1.7 months of spending. Staff pay was 23%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ash.
